Unanswered: radio speaker

When i got my 72 gt, it had some rigged up explode speakers behind the seats. I removed them and just replaced the tray in the window. The new tray has an uncut speaker hole and id like to keep it looking nice. What kind of speaker originally came with the car? Its probably a long shot to find one but has anyone found a speaker that will mount to that speaker cover that mounts in the tray? As long as i dont have to cut out the hole i am fine.

If you are using anything like a modern stereo, you won't like the sound that comes from an original type speaker.
You can match up speakers (3" x 5"?) to the stock mounts. There are two other pieces besides the deck. There is a speaker plate (with felt isolation strips) and the speaker cover (plastic, but there are some metal louvered covers, too).

Check with Crutchfield for possible replacements. You'll need the dimensions for the actual hole and the studs.

Look for a decent 3way. If you run only one speaker it will at least have a fuller range.
